Biathlon: Quentin Fillon-Maillet at the top in Nove Mesto

2021-03-13T15:55:48.694Z


After the sprint on Thursday, Quentin Fillon-Maillet signed the double with the pursuit at Nove Mesto. 


Frenchman Quentin Fillon-Maillet, who won the sprint on Thursday, scored twice by winning the pursuit of Nove Mesto, in Czechia, on Saturday, counting towards the Biathlon World Cup.

Fillon-Maillet (28) signed his third victory of the season, the sixth of his career, beating the Norwegian Johannes Boe and the French Emilien Jacquelin.

Despite two rifle faults, Fillon-Maillet took advantage of a last impeccable standing shot to subdue all the other favorites.The Frenchman, unhappy at the Pokljuka Worlds (no title, only one medal) and left behind in the general classification of the The World Cup, his main goal of the winter, confirms his good momentum at the end of the season.In the race for the big crystal globe, the double-holding Johannes Boe performed an excellent operation in three rounds of the outcome, his rival Sturla Holm Laegreid having only finished fourth.

Boe is now 36 points ahead of his young compatriot (24) .According to the rules of the International Biathlon Federation (IBU), however, it will be necessary to subtract at the end of the season the four worst results of each biathlete.

Boe is therefore virtually only seven points ahead of Laegreid.
